Saturday, June 4, 2011

It's a jungle out there!

This week I have been working on a baby shower cake for another jungle themed baby shower.  I modeled this cake after the one Lindsay and I had made last year for my sister-in-law - but this time I did it all by myself!  :)  And wow, this cake took forever - about 10 hours in total from baking to decorating.

The bottom tier is a lemon cake with vanilla filling and buttercream frosting.  The top tier is a red velvet cake with cream cheese filling and frosting. 

I used a zebra print design for the bottom and a giraffe print design for the top, both with green leaves and colorful flowers to make it "pop".  Then, I handmade from gumpaste and fondant a giraffe, an elephant, and a tree.  This was my first solo attempt at 3-D characters, and while they are not "amazing", they turned out decent.

Saturday, May 21, 2011

Cupcake Weekend

This weekend I had two big projects - an engagement party and a baby shower!

For the engagement party, I was asked to make 60 mini cupcakes with my chocolate chip cupcake recipe.  These were fun to make - they are chocolate chip cupcakes filled with dark chocolate ganache and buttercream frosting.  I put little pearls on top to make them classy... :)






The baby shower was regular size cupcakes.  20 were red velvet with cream cheese filling, 20 were lemon with lemon filling, and 20 were chocolate chip with dark chocolate ganache filling.  All have buttercream frosting.  I handmade 60 sports balls for decorations out of fondant.  :)
